Why does my local card fail on AWS & cloud in Dominican Republic?
AWS & cloud often bills through international acquirers. Domestic-only debit profiles or BINs without cross-border authorization are declined at the network - not necessarily by AWS & cloud's UI. GetPlu is a Visa card built for that billing profile.
